> But basically, you can write a custom tag so that you can do partial page
> caching like so:
>
> <cf_cache name="sectionFoo">
> content
> </cf_cache>
>
> This custom tag would store the data in either the application, server, or
> session cache.
There are already similar custom tags around, like "CF_SuperCache" (check
the Exchange) or "CF_Accelerate":
http://www.bpurcell.org/blog/index.cfm?mode=entry&entry=963
